In recent years, the automotive parts export market has seen a remarkable surge. With increasing demand for vehicle maintenance and repairs worldwide, exporters are strategically placing themselves at the forefront of this booming industry.
The global automotive market is evolving, driven by technological advancements and shifting consumer preferences. As electric vehicles (EVs) become more mainstream, the need for advanced parts and innovative solutions is growing.
While the opportunities are plentiful, automotive parts exporters face various challenges including compliance with international regulations, fluctuating tariffs, and varying quality standards across markets.
To thrive in this competitive landscape, exporters must adopt a customer-centric approach. Establishing strong partnerships and leveraging technology can greatly enhance operational efficiency.
With the right strategies in place, automotive parts exporters can continue to drive global trade and contribute significantly to the growth of the automotive industry.
